&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Khalid Aucho&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; (born 8 August 1993) is a Ugandan professional [[association football|footballer]] who plays as a [[defensive midfielder]] for [[Tanzanian Premier League]] club [[Singida Black Stars FC|Singida Black Stars]] and [[Captain (association football)|captains]] the [[Uganda national football team|Uganda national team]].&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;nft&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{NFT|54276}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|title=Churchill Bros back in I-League|url=https://www.heraldgoa.in/Sports/Churchill-Bros-back-in-ILeague-/136346.html|work=heraldgoa.com|access-date=19 September 2018|archive-date=15 September 2022|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220915031855/https://www.heraldgoa.in/Sports/Churchill-Bros-back-in-ILeague-/136346.html|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=https://www.panafricafootball.com/post/uganda-star-khalid-aucho-joins-singida-black-stars-on-a-two-year-deal/|title=Khalid Aucho Joins Singida BS|publisher=panafricafootball.com}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ho has played football in various clubs, such as Jinja Municipal Council F.C. from 2009 to 2010, Water F.C from Uganda from 2010 to 2012, [[Simba FC]] from Uganda, [[Tusker F.C.|Tusker]] from Kenya, [[Gor Mahia F.C.|Gor Mahia]] from Kenya, and [[Baroka F.C.|Baroka]] from the South African [[Premier Soccer League]]. He was on the Uganda team that qualified for the [[Africa Cup of Nations]] for the first time in 38 years.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==Early life==&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ho was born in [[Jinja, Uganda|Jinja]], Uganda. He attended Namagabi Primary School – Kayunga, St Thudus (O-level), Iganga Mixed School (A-level).&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;kawowo&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{Cite news|url=https://www.kawowo.com/2013/12/02/orphan-status-inspires-cranes-player-khalid-aucho/|title=Orphan Status Inspires Cranes New Revelation Khalid Aucho|date=2 December 2013|work=Kawowo Sports|access-date=6 April 2018|language=en-US|archive-date=6 April 2018|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20180406163844/https://www.kawowo.com/2013/12/02/orphan-status-inspires-cranes-player-khalid-aucho/|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

==Club career==&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Gor Mahia===&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ho played for Kenya Premier League side [[Gor Mahia F.C.|Gor Mahia]] from 2015 to May 2016.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| title=Soka.co.ke | url=http://www.soka.co.ke/tag/khalid_aucho/8 | website=www.soka.co.ke | access-date=25 August 2016 | archive-date=4 October 2018 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181004061804/http://www.soka.co.ke/tag/khalid_aucho/8 |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; He joined GorMahia from Tusker and was unveiled on 8 January 2015 at Nyayo Stadium.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| url=http://bigeye.ug/khalid-aucho-joins-kenyas-gor-mahia/ | title=KHALID AUCHO JOINS KENYA&amp;#039;S GOR MAHIA | first=James Robert | last=Kayindi | publisher=Bigeye.ug | date=9 January 2015 | access-date=9 June 2017 | archive-date=30 March 2017 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170330233547/http://bigeye.ug/khalid-aucho-joins-kenyas-gor-mahia/ |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; He scored his first goal for GorMahia on 22 March 2015 in the 41st minute against Chemilli Sugars F.C. with GorMahia winning 3–1.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ite web|url=https://www.whoscored.com/Matches/932518/Live/Kenya-Premier-League-2015-Gor-Mahia-Chemelil-Sugar|title=Gor Mahia 3-1 Chemelil Sugar - Premier League 2015 Live|website=www.whoscored.com|language=en|access-date=6 April 2018|archive-date=31 March 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170331055558/https://www.whoscored.com/Matches/932518/Live/Kenya-Premier-League-2015-Gor-Mahia-Chemelil-Sugar|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; Aucho played his last game for GorMahia on 25 May 2016 at Moi Stadium Kisumu against Sofapaka F.C., where he headed in the opener for the Kenyan champions in the sixth minute, with GorMahia finishing the first leg on top of the table having 29 points.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;[http://www.goal.com/en-ke/match/gor-mahia-vs-sofapaka/2213853/report Gor Mahia vs Sofapaka report] {{Webarchive|url=https://web.archive.org/web/20161222083318/http://www.goal.com/en-ke/match/gor-mahia-vs-sofapaka/2213853/report |date=22 December 2016 }} at goal.com&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In July 2016, Aucho went on trial at [[Scottish Premiership]] side Aberdeen.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| last1=Oguda | first1=Zachary | title=All set for Aucho as he heads to Scotland | url=http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/all-set-for-aucho-as-he-heads-to-scotland | access-date=25 August 2016 | archive-date=4 October 2018 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181004061740/http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/all-set-for-aucho-as-he-heads-to-scotland |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| last1=Opiyo | first1=Vincent | title=Khalid Aucho impresses as Aberdeen thump Arbroath in friendly | url=http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/khalid-aucho-impresses-as-aberdeen-thump-arbroath-in-friendly | access-date=25 August 2016 | archive-date=4 October 2018 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181004062642/http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/khalid-aucho-impresses-as-aberdeen-thump-arbroath-in-friendly |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; The move to Aberdeen collapsed, however, after a transfer fee snag between the clubs.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web |url=http://www.ultimatesports.co/2016/08/04/khalid-aucho-aberdeen-deal-flops/#sthash.X7figOFX.dpuf |title=Ultimate Sports {{!}} Khalid Aucho Aberdeen deal flops |website=www.ultimatesports.co |url-status=dead |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20161222152705/http://www.ultimatesports.co/2016/08/04/khalid-aucho-aberdeen-deal-flops/ |archive-date=2016-12-22}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; After unsuccessful trials in Scotland, Aucho was signed by Baroka F.C. from South Africa at a fee reported to be 200,000 Rands (approximately KSh1.6million).&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ite web|url=http://www.standardmedia.co.ke/m/article/2000215862/gor-mahia-cash-in-on-aucho-s-transfer|title=Gor Mahia cash in on Aucho&amp;#039;s transfer|last=Wandera|first=Gilbert|website=Standard Digital News|language=en|access-date=17 May 2018|archive-date=31 March 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170331003624/http://www.standardmedia.co.ke/m/article/2000215862/gor-mahia-cash-in-on-aucho-s-transfer|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Baroka===&lt;br /&gt;
On 24 August 2016, Aucho was signed by Premier Soccer League side [[Baroka F.C.|Baroka]].&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| last1=Opiyo | first1=Vincent | title=BREAKING: Khalid Aucho completes Baroka FC switch | url=http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/breaking-khalid-aucho-completes-baroka-fc-switch | access-date=25 August 2016 | archive-date=4 October 2018 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181004061610/http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/breaking-khalid-aucho-completes-baroka-fc-switch |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; He made his debut on 15 October 2016 in a Premier Soccer League match played at Cape Town Stadium at the 50th minute replacing Chauke Mfundhisii.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|url=http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/aucho-starts-baroka-business-positively|title=Aucho starts Baroka business positively|last=Stephen|first=Vincent|access-date=17 May 2018|language=en|archive-date=4 October 2018|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181004061023/http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/aucho-starts-baroka-business-positively|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Serbia===&lt;br /&gt;
In February 2017, in the last days of the winter transfer period, Aucho went to [[Red Star Belgrade]] following a recommendation by the Uganda national team coach [[Milutin Sredojević]]. Red Star immediately sent him to [[OFK Beograd]] on loan until the end of the season.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;[http://www.zurnal.rs/fudbal/zvezda/45221/zvezda-dovela-reprezentativca-ugande-i-odmah-ga-poslala-na-pozajmicu-video?lang=lat Zvezda dovela reprezentativca Ugande i odmah ga poslala na pozajmicu (VIDEO)] {{Webarchive|url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170222110201/http://www.zurnal.rs/fudbal/zvezda/45221/zvezda-dovela-reprezentativca-ugande-i-odmah-ga-poslala-na-pozajmicu-video?lang=lat |date=22 February 2017 }} at [[Sportski žurnal]], 20 February 2017 {{in lang|sr}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; Due to administrative problems with missing visa, Aucho formally signed a six-month deal with OFK Beograd.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=http://fss.rs/documents/fudbal/2017/fudbal_11_2017.pdf|title=&amp;quot;FUDBAL&amp;quot; 11/17 - page 691|website=[[Football Association of Serbia]]|language=sr|date=15 March 2017|access-date=22 June 2017|archive-date=17 March 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170317143628/http://www.fss.rs/documents/fudbal/2017/fudbal_11_2017.pdf|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; Next the club was relegated to the [[Serbian League Belgrade]], Aucho trained with Red Star Belgrade for a period in 2017,&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=http://www.crvenazvezdafk.com/scc/vest/5909/kalid-auco-prikljucen-ekipi|script-title=sr:Калид Аучо прикључен екипи|website=Red Star Belgrade official website|language=sr|date=22 May 2017|access-date=22 June 2017|archive-date=26 July 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170726181735/http://www.crvenazvezdafk.com/scc/vest/5909/Kalid-Auco-prikljucen-ekipi|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; after which he left the club in June same year.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=http://www.mozzartsport.com/vesti/nije-debitovao-a-vec-ide-rastali-se-zvezda-i-kalid-auco/170883|title=Nije debitovao, a već ide: Rastali se Zvezda i Kalid Aučo|website=mozzartsport.com|language=sr|date=22 June 2017|access-date=22 June 2017|archive-date=25 June 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170625024235/http://www.mozzartsport.com/vesti/nije-debitovao-a-vec-ide-rastali-se-zvezda-i-kalid-auco/170883|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===India===&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ho joined East Bengal February for last few matches of the 2017–18 [[I-league]] and [[Indian Super Cup]]. He featured all the four matches of the club in [[2018 Indian Super Cup]]. He was released after the competition.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In September 2018 he joined another Indian club in [[Churchill Brothers S.C.|Churchill Brothers]].&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=https://www.goal.com/en-us/news/churchill-brothers-sign-khalid-aucho-retain-dawda-ceesay-hussein-/1xd0zyn4s3pe01neh2ofdz9snj|title=Churchill Brothers sign Khalid Aucho; retain Dawda Ceesay, Hussein Eldor, Willis Plaza|website=goal.com|date=28 May 2018|access-date=5 April 2019|archive-date=5 April 2019|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20190405221711/https://www.goal.com/en-us/news/churchill-brothers-sign-khalid-aucho-retain-dawda-ceesay-hussein-/1xd0zyn4s3pe01neh2ofdz9snj|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=https://khelnow.com/news/article/i-league-2nd-division-khalid-aucho-newchurchill-brothers-signings|title=Exclusive: Khalid Aucho and Gerard Williams set to sign for Churchill Brothers|website=24 May 2018|date=24 May 2018|access-date=5 April 2019|archive-date=5 April 2019|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20190405221713/https://khelnow.com/news/article/i-league-2nd-division-khalid-aucho-newchurchill-brothers-signings|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; He made his league debut for the club on 28 October 2018, playing all ninety minutes in a 0–0 away draw with [[Minerva Punjab F.C.|Minerva Punjab]].&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=https://int.soccerway.com/matches/2018/10/28/india/i-league/india-minerva-fc/churchill-brothers-sc/2928125/|title=Minerva Punjab vs. Churchill Brothers – 28 October 2018|website=Soccerway|access-date=5 April 2019|archive-date=15 September 2020|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20200915230900/https://int.soccerway.com/matches/2018/10/28/india/i-league/india-minerva-fc/churchill-brothers-sc/2928125/|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; He scored his first league goal for the club on 9 December 2018 in a 4–1 home victory over [[Aizawl F.C.]] His goal, assisted by [[Israil Gurung]], was scored in the 23rd minute and made the score 1–0 to Churchill Brothers.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web|url=https://int.soccerway.com/matches/2018/12/09/india/i-league/churchill-brothers-sc/aizawl-fc/2928162/|title=Churchill Brothers vs. Aizawl – 9 December 2018|website=Soccerway|access-date=5 April 2019|archive-date=17 August 2021|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20210817111058/https://int.soccerway.com/matches/2018/12/09/india/i-league/churchill-brothers-sc/aizawl-fc/2928162/|url-status=live}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Makkasa===&lt;br /&gt;
In July 2019 Aucho joined [[Misr Lel Makkasa SC|Makkasa]] on a two-year contract.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ite news | url=https://kawowo.com/2019/07/07/uganda-cranes-midfielder-aucho-seals-deal-at-egyptian-top-flight-side/ | title=Uganda Cranes midfielder Aucho seals deal at Egyptian top flight side | first=David | last=Isabirye | date=7 July 2019 | publisher=Kawowo Sports | access-date=22 August 2019 | archive-date=17 August 2021 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20210817105554/https://kawowo.com/2019/07/07/uganda-cranes-midfielder-aucho-seals-deal-at-egyptian-top-flight-side/ |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; In his first season at the club he made 21 appearances scoring twice,&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;youngafricans&amp;quot;/&amp;gt; in his second season he made 13 appearances.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;youngafricans&amp;quot;/&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Young Africans===&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ho moved to Tanzanian club [[Young Africans S.C.|Young Africans]] in August 2021.&amp;lt;ref name=&amp;quot;youngafricans&amp;quot;&amp;gt;{{cite news |last1=Ismail |first1=Ali |title=Misr El-Makkasa midfielder Aucho signs for Young Africans |url=https://www.kingfut.com/2021/08/11/aucho-signs-for-young-africans/ |access-date=20 August 2021 |work=Kingfut |date=11 August 2021 |archive-date=15 September 2022 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220915031901/https://www.kingfut.com/2021/08/11/aucho-signs-for-young-africans/ |url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==International career==&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ho made his debut for the [[Uganda national football team|Uganda national team]] (the &amp;quot;Cranes&amp;quot;) against [[Rwanda national football team|Rwanda]] in a 1–0 victory at the [[2013 CECAFA Cup]]. He scored his first international goal in a match against [[Sudan national football team|Sudan]] to give his side a 1–0 victory in the [[2013 CECAFA Cup group stage|group stage]] of the same competition.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| url=http://www.newvision.co.ug/news/650232-aucho-inspires-cranes-past-sudan.html | title=Aucho inspires Cranes past Sudan | publisher=New Vision | date=4 December 2013 | access-date=16 February 2014 | author=Kenyi, Swalley | archive-date=14 February 2014 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20140214133355/http://www.newvision.co.ug/news/650232-aucho-inspires-cranes-past-sudan.html |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In June 2016, Aucho scored on an overhead kick from his own penalty box in a 2–1 away win over [[Botswana national football team|Botswana]] in a qualifying game for the [[2017 Africa Cup of Nations]].&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| last1=Oguda | first1=Zachary | title=AFCON: Aucho on the mark as Uganda goes top | publisher=Soka | date=4 June 2016 | access-date=9 June 2017 | url=http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/afcon-aucho-on-the-mark-as-uganda-goes-top | archive-date=30 March 2017 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170330234315/http://www.soka.co.ke/news/item/afcon-aucho-on-the-mark-as-uganda-goes-top |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ho was on the Uganda team that qualified for the [[Africa Cup of Nations]] for the first time in 38 years on 4 September 2016.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ite news |last1=Kiyonga |first1=Ismael |title=Burkina Faso Vs Uganda: Who is who in the Cranes squad? |url=https://kawowo.com/2016/03/24/burkina-faso-vs-uganda-who-is-who-in-the-cranes-squad-afcon-2017-qualifiers/ |access-date=1 January 2022 |work=Kawowo |date=24 March 2016 |archive-date=1 January 2022 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220101210150/https://kawowo.com/2016/03/24/burkina-faso-vs-uganda-who-is-who-in-the-cranes-squad-afcon-2017-qualifiers/ |url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ite news |last1=Isabirye |first1=David |title=Uganda Cranes qualify for AFCON after 38 years |url=https://kawowo.com/2016/09/04/uganda-cranes-qualify-for-afcon-after-38-years/ |access-date=1 January 2022 |work=Kawowo |date=4 September 2016 |archive-date=1 January 2022 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220101210149/https://kawowo.com/2016/09/04/uganda-cranes-qualify-for-afcon-after-38-years/ |url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Aucho was called up by head coach Milutin Sredojević to the Uganda national football team for the 2017 Africa Cup of Nations.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| url=http://www.fufa.co.ug/total-africa-cup-nations-2017-uganda-cranes-23-man-squad-gabon-named/ | title=Total Africa Cup Of Nations 2017: Uganda Cranes 23 Man Squad To Gabon Named | date=4 January 2017 | access-date=17 January 2017 | work=Federation of Uganda Football Associations | archive-date=28 September 2018 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20180928180809/http://www.fufa.co.ug/total-africa-cup-nations-2017-uganda-cranes-23-man-squad-gabon-named/ |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t; He missed the first game against [[Ghana national football team|Ghana]] on 17 January 2017 because of suspension.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web | url=http://theugandan.com.ug/murshid-juuko-khalid-aucho-ruled-uganda-v-ghana/ | title=Murshid Juuko and Khalid Aucho ruled out of Uganda v Ghana | date=17 January 2017 | access-date=17 January 2017 | work=The Ugandan | archive-date=9 August 2018 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20180809153059/https://theugandan.com.ug/murshid-juuko-khalid-aucho-ruled-uganda-v-ghana/ | url-status=live }}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
